Because the tune is way off. Basically the trims have learned the 21% correction and are "instantly/short term" adjusting -2 to +4% of fuel. You Should try running the 85mm tune and see how that works.

Well, I'm not sure which tune the "85mm" is since its not listed in the available tunes...however I did manage to get it dialed in.tuningss wrote:You Should try running the 85mm tune and see how that works.
I tried a few different tunes, but most were worse than the origionally suggested K&N tune (even with MAF adjustments). However, it dawned on me that most CAI's are 3.5" or less: K&N, AirAid, Roush, etc.. All except the JLT intake. That tube on the JLT is so short that the tune would have to be radically different and be set for having more air available. The Spectre CAI is a 4" tube, oh, and I removed the black insert (to choke it down to 3" ID) allowing even more airflow than Spectre intended. Anyway, the net result of this was JLT had to be pretty close.
In a nutshell, the JLT 91 octane tune (91 gas, of course), coupled with increasing the MAF curve 16% got me almost perfect:
0% LTFT
-2 to +4% STFT
